Cédric Villemain wrote: > > - The statistics gathered by ANALYZE are independent of the tablespace > > containing the table. > > yes. > > > - The tablespace containing the table has no influence on query planning > > unless seq_page_cost or random_page_cost has been set on the > > tablespace. > > yes. > > > - VACUUM ANALYZE does the same as VACUUM followed by ANALYZE. > > no. > it is fine grained, but in the diffs there is: > > VACUUM and ANALYSE do not update pg_class the same way for the > reltuples/relpages: for ex VACUUM is accurate for index, and ANALYZE is fuzzy > so if you issue a vacuum you have exact values, if you then run ANALYZE you > may change them to be less precise.
